Summary

This project will provide autism youth with hands-on career training and workplace experiences at the Inclusion Factory in Taicang, Jiangsu Province, a social enterprise employing 50 individuals with intellectual disabilities. By building their confidence, enhancing vocational skills, and supporting their integration into society, this program will help 10 youth and their families overcome barriers to independence and inclusion.

Challenge

Young individuals with autism face significant barriers to employment and social integration. According to statistics, the employment rate for autistic youth is less than 2%, highlighting the severe lack of opportunities available to this group. After leaving school or rehabilitation centers, they often lack the vocational training and practical work experience needed to enter the workforce. Solution

This project addresses the employment and social integration challenges faced by autistic youth by providing a 5-day career experience program at the Inclusion Factory, a social enterprise employing 50 individuals with intellectual disabilities. The program offers hands-on job training, safety workshops, and daily feedback sessions, equipping participants with practical skills and workplace confidence. Important Notice about Projects in China

The Government of People’s Republic of China has implemented new regulations for foreign NGOs operating in China. GlobalGiving must receive Government approval before we can disburse funds to organizations registered in Mainland China. This means that the disbursement of your donation to this project may be slightly delayed while we obtain the appropriate approval.
